Slashdot Mirror


FSF Releases AGPL License For Web Services

mako writes "The Free Software Foundation has released the Affero General Public license version 3. The license is essentially the GPLv3 with an added clause that requires that source code be distributed to users that interact with the application over a network. The license effectively extends copyright to Web applications. The new AGPL will have important effects for companies that, under the GPL, have no obligation to distribute changes to users on the Web. This release adds the license to the stable of official FSF licenses and is compatible with the GPLv3."

4 of 276 comments (clear)

  1. really? by rucs_hack · · Score: 5, Insightful

    The new AGPL will have important effects for companies that, under the GPL, have no obligation to distribute changes to users on the Web

    Only if they use it. No-one's under an obligation to use a new version of a licence, and if they don't like the terms, they may steer clear of it to start with.

    1. Re:really? by DirtyHerring · · Score: 3, Insightful

      You write ReallyCoolWebTool and license it under the AGPL. GreedyBastardCompany wants to use and change it. Now they have the choice between releasing their source code, or not using it at all. That was different with the GPL.

  2. Ug by pat+mcguire · · Score: 3, Insightful

    I've been against this clause ever since I heard GPLv3 was adding compatibility. One of the important parts of the GPL is that it allows private development if the changes weren't distributed - this is an important thing, as there's no user to protect if it's made for self consumption. The four freedoms that RMS always speak of aren't threatened by this, as the user is the same as the writer - there's no oppression that needs to be stopped here. The addition is a corruption of the GPL, changing it's purpose from one of freedom for all users to the coercive obtainment of the source code at any cost.

  3. No you troll by SmallFurryCreature · · Score: 3, Insightful

    This guy is trolling, he purposefully misreads the license and tries to introduce the old troll that GPL software means that what is produced with that software must be GPL'ed as well. This is offcourse complete and utter nonsense, but it is a regular troll that usually gets modded down pretty quickly.

    He just tries a new angle with the AGPL. To make it clear for those who don't understand the license. Slashdot is run on custom code, lets say that it is released under the GPL, you can now take that code, install it on your own server (scream a bit as you release what you have just done) and run your own site with it (although it never will be quite like slashdot unless you hire a finite number of monkeys as your editors). So far so good. Now you modify this code. To hide your shame you don't actually distribute the code in question, just run it on your own server. A GPL license in this case would NOT force you to release these modifications, the GPL only triggers when you distribute the code/program to others. Google for instance uses a modified GPL code, but because they don't distribute are under no obligation to distribute the modified code (they do distribute some of it although they don't have too).

    IF however the slash code was released under the AGPL you would be forced to distribute your modifications.

    BUT at no point would the END result of the code/program fall under any license other then that which you choose. In this case, the HTML pages created would OFFCOURSE not fall under the AGPL or GPL or ANY license unless you choose one yourselve. (does machine created content fall under basic copyright?)

    This is very clear from the license text and only a deliberate misreading by someone wishing to troll could result in any other explenation.

    The GPL/AGPL are about the program/code, NOT about the results of the program/code. Anyone who tries to claim something else is an idiot.

    It says a lot about slashdot moderation that this tired old troll was modded up. He tries to disguise himself by saying that he is happy to be corrected but before without trying to link Stallman to communism (the gpl is far closer to the true idea of a free market) and without having spouted a lot of outright crap first.

    Now if you excuse me, I have to use windows for an hour as punishement for feeding the troll.

    --

    MMO Quests are like orgasms:

    You may solo them, I prefer them in a group.